is a third-party modified version of the Windows 10 operating system, not an official release from Microsoft . These builds are typically created by enthusiasts who "strip down" the standard OS to reduce background processes and system resource usage. Key Characteristics of "Gamer Edition" Builds

Micro-stutters often happen when background Windows tasks suddenly spike CPU usage. By disabling automated maintenance tasks, Windows Defender scans, and Windows Update delivery optimization during active hours, these custom builds provide a much smoother frame-time consistency.
